### Sweeper API

The Orphanet sweeper scans the Fennel cluster nightly for resources with no owning deployment — dangling volumes, stale load balancers, unreferenced snapshots. Candidates sit in a 72-hour quarantine queue before deletion; anything tagged `keep` is skipped. The sweeper authenticates to the Fennel control plane with a scoped service credential, which for the current environment is listed below.

API key for fahip-kahip: zpat23_XiJGUHz5xfaAtaIqUkus0rh

= Off-site backup tape transport =

Every Friday the Merrowdale records team sends the week's backup tapes to the Stonegate vault. Tapes go in the blue transit tote — yes, the ugly one — with the clasp seal snapped shut. Jot the tape count and seal number in the transport log, and don't stack anything on top of the tote while it waits at reception. The vault's courier does the rest. Before the courier leaves, read them this confidential hand-over instruction.

handover note for yagef-bagep: the drudor pelius courier leaves the kasdor zorvan norir ledger at gate 8016 under passcode 755406

### Action Item: Spoolhaven Retry Storm

From last Tuesday's outage: the Spoolhaven print service retried failed jobs without backoff, saturating the render pool. Fix merged; retries now use capped exponential backoff with jitter. Owner will monitor for a week before closing. The agreed retry constants are recorded below.

constants for yadup-kajof:
RATE_LIMITS = {
    "zorwyn": 1,
    "druwyn": 1,
}

## Step 7: Enable bulk edits in the Ledgerette admin table

Before flipping the feature flag, confirm the background worker pool has drained, since bulk edits acquire row locks that conflict with in-flight single-row updates. If an incident occurs mid-migration, roll back the flag first and the schema second — never the reverse. Once the queue is empty, apply the worker configuration values listed below.

config for hahip-kaguf:
[holath]
port = 8443
region = north-4
host = holath.tolvaqlabs.internal
timeout_ms = 1000
retries = 2